A woman shared a video of her shattered shower door on the social media site TikTok this week, saying it unexpectedly exploded on her while in use.  

The woman, who posted the video on her TikTok page Kai’s World, says that the incident caused lacerations that required stitches. Hundreds of thousands have viewed the video, but the problem of shower doors exploding unexpectedly is not new.

Just weeks earlier, a North Carolina couple reported that their shower door exploded without warning. 

The couple told local reporters at 7 News that they heard a “boom” while at their home on a Saturday night in late April. They say they found glass in the bathroom as well as the bedroom from the unexpected explosion.  

“Thank God we didn’t have anybody in the bathroom when it happened,” homeowner Kathy Loftin told reporters. “When I researched it I said, ‘hey, we’re not an anomaly.’ This has happened before and people don’t know it.” 

Indeed, approximately 500 people suffer injuries from shattering shower doors that send them to the hospital emergency rooms each year, according to US consumer protection agencies. Exploding shower doors also still happen despite a 2016 safety alert issued by the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) which required changes to how tempered glass products were made.  

Other glass products have been known to spontaneously shatter as well, from Pyrex dishes to car windshields. Another woman was injured by an exploding shower door in 2018. The woman, a yoga instructor, said that she was exiting a hotel shower when it unexpectedly shattered behind her. She told the New York Post that she was taken to the emergency room where it took hours to remove pieces of glass from her body and for her to receive 30 stitches.  

Experts say there are a number of reasons why glass shower doors may explode unexpectedly, from temperature variations to problems with how they were made or installed. The Spruce recommends that homeowners with a glass shower door routinely inspect it for cracks or other problems.
